Luxury Wine Market Trends, Growth Opportunities, and Forecast Scenarios
The luxury wine market is experiencing growth opportunities fueled by several market trends. One key trend is the increasing demand for premium and high-quality wines among consumers who are willing to spend more for exclusive and unique products. This trend is driven by a growing number of wine enthusiasts and connoisseurs who seek exceptional tasting experiences and are willing to invest in luxury wines.
Another important trend is the rise of the experiential wine consumption trend, where consumers are looking for immersive and personalized wine experiences. This has led to the growth of vineyard tours, wine tastings, and other wine-related events that cater to the luxury wine market segment.
The shift towards online sales and e-commerce has also contributed to the growth of the luxury wine market, as it allows consumers to easily access and purchase high-end wines from around the world. This trend has opened up new distribution channels and opportunities for both established and emerging luxury wine brands.
Overall, the luxury wine market is projected to continue growing in the coming years, driven by evolving consumer preferences, increasing disposable incomes, and a growing global market for premium wines. As the market continues to expand, there are numerous growth opportunities for luxury wine brands to innovate, create unique products, and engage with consumers through tailored experiences to capture a larger share of this affluent and discerning market segment.

In terms of Product Application, the Luxury Wine market is segmented into:
Luxury wine is used in various applications such as wholesale, retail stores, department stores, and online retailers. Wholesale businesses purchase luxury wine in bulk quantities to supply to restaurants and hotels. Retail stores and department stores sell luxury wine directly to consumers. Online retailers provide a convenient platform for customers to browse and purchase luxury wine from the comfort of their homes. The fastest growing application segment in terms of revenue is online retailers, as more consumers are opting for the convenience of purchasing luxury wine online. This trend is expected to continue as e-commerce continues to grow.
